Top 20 Advanced SQL Interview Questions and Answers

1. What is the difference between clustered and non-clustered indexes?

Answer:

  • Clustered Index: Organises data rows physically in order based on the index key. Only one clustered index per table.
  • Non-Clustered Index: Separate from the actual data rows, containing pointers. A table can have multiple non-clustered indexes.

2. What is the purpose of a CTE (Common Table Expression)?

Answer:
A CTE makes complex queries easier to manage and read. It’s useful for breaking down large queries into understandable parts and is essential for recursive queries.

3. Explain the ACID properties of a transaction.

Answer:

  • Atomicity: All operations succeed or none do.
  • Consistency: The database remains in a valid state.
  • Isolation: Transactions do not interfere with each other.
  • Durability: Changes persist even after a system failure.

4. How does indexing affect performance?

Answer:
Indexes speed up data retrieval but can slow down write operations. They are essential for optimizing read-heavy applications but should be used judiciously.

5. What is normalization? Why is it important?

Answer:
Normalization structures a database to minimize redundancy and improve data integrity, typically following normal forms like 1NF, 2NF, and 3NF.

6. What is denormalization?

Answer:
Denormalization introduces redundancy to enhance read performance, often used in reporting systems where read speed is prioritized over update performance.

7. How do SQL Joins work? Name different types.

Answer:

  • INNER JOIN, LEFT JOIN, RIGHT JOIN, FULL JOIN, CROSS JOIN — all combine records from two or more tables based on logical relationships.

8. What’s the difference between DELETE and TRUNCATE?

Answer:

  • DELETE: Removes rows individually and can be filtered.
  • TRUNCATE: Removes all rows quickly without individual-row logging.

9. What is a correlated subquery?

Answer:
A subquery that depends on the outer query for its values — evaluated repeatedly for each row processed by the outer query.

10. Explain window functions.

Answer:
Functions like ROW_NUMBER(), RANK(), DENSE_RANK(), LEAD(), LAG() allow computations across sets of rows related to the current query row without collapsing the result set.

11. How do you optimize SQL queries?

Answer:
Use selective columns, proper indexes, avoid complex joins when unnecessary, leverage CTEs, and study execution plans.

12. What is a deadlock? How can you prevent it?

Answer:
A deadlock happens when two transactions block each other. Prevent it by acquiring locks in the same order, keeping transactions short, and using lock timeout strategies.

13. What are materialized views, and how do they differ from regular views?

Answer:
Materialized views store query results physically, unlike standard views that are re-executed on demand.

14. How do you handle NULL values in SQL?

Answer:
Use IS NULL, COALESCE(), or NULLIF() to properly handle NULLs without introducing logical errors.

15. What’s the difference between UNION and UNION ALL?

Answer:

  • UNION removes duplicates.
  • UNION ALL keeps all records (including duplicates).

16. How does indexing impact JOIN performance?

Answer:
Indexes on join columns significantly reduce lookup time and improve query performance by preventing full table scans.

17. What is a surrogate key?

Answer:
A surrogate key is an artificial, unique identifier (often numeric) assigned to each record, independent of the actual data.

18. How do stored procedures differ from functions?

Answer:
Stored procedures can modify data and manage transactions; functions are intended to return a value and cannot change data.

19. Explain database sharding.

Answer:
Sharding splits a database horizontally to distribute the data across multiple machines, improving performance and scalability.

20. What are SQL triggers, and when should you use them carefully?

Answer:
Triggers automatically execute in response to table events. Overusing triggers can make systems harder to debug and maintain.

Frequently Asked Questions (FAQs)

Q1. What types of SQL questions are asked for 3–5 years experienced professionals?

Expect advanced topics like query optimization, handling large datasets, transaction control, complex JOINs, CTEs, and indexing strategies.

Q2. How important is it to know indexing strategies for SQL interviews?

Extremely important. Good indexing improves performance and showcases your ability to work with real-world data challenges.

Q3. What are common mistakes candidates make in advanced SQL interviews?

Using SELECT *, ignoring execution plans, mishandling NULLs, overcomplicating queries, and poor transaction management are typical pitfalls.

Q4. Should I focus more on normalization or denormalization for technical interviews?

Both are important — know how to normalize for data integrity and when to denormalize for performance optimization.

Q5. Are triggers and stored procedures still relevant topics for SQL interviews in 2025?

Yes. They’re critical for implementing complex business rules and maintaining database integrity.

Q6. How can I approach SQL query optimization questions during interviews?

Focus on identifying bottlenecks, suggesting indexes, rewriting queries for efficiency, and explaining your optimization steps clearly.

Q7. What advanced JOIN concepts should I be familiar with for SQL interviews?

Understand self-joins, anti-joins, semi-joins, and how JOINs behave with large datasets for real-world SQL challenges.

Q8. What’s the role of transaction isolation levels in SQL interviews?

Isolation levels define how transactions interact — understanding when and why to adjust them is key to optimizing concurrency and integrity.
